The term derives from a river located in present-day Turkey and known to the Greeks as (Μαίανδρος) Maiandros or Maeander, characterised by a very convoluted path along the lower reach. This is called a meander., The outside of the meander is eroded more and more., The neck gets narrower and narrower., During a time of flood the river cuts across the neck., Deposition occurs along the old channel., The loop is sealed off and an oxbow lake forms.. Start Creating Now The following diagram is of Meander that forms an oxbow lake generally in a broad flood plain: Physical Processes of Bank Erosion As flow enters the bank of an alluvial river, the centrifugal force created by the bend instigates helicoidal flow, a corkscrew like pattern of flow, which drives the hydraulic action acting on the opposing bank. As such, even in Classical Greece (and in later Greek thought) the name of the river had become a common noun meaning anything convoluted and winding, such as decorative patterns or speech and ideas, as well as the geomorphological feature. It is produced by a stream or river swinging from side to side as it flows across its floodplain or shifts its channel within a valley. The formation of meanders in straight rivers and streams is largely dependent on disturbances.
